So im trying to find a different source of fluke tabs, they have the side effect of killing blue clove polyps and gsp. They no longer seem to make them, so w the active ingrediants being methl-5-benzol-benzimidazole-2-carbamate
dimethyl(2,2,2-trichlor-1-hydroxyethyl) phosphonate, any idea what part kills them and a alternative. thanks
 
im trying to get rid of all the blue clove polyps that are taking over my tank. fluke tabs were found to have that side effect, but they dont seem to make them anymore.

Either one, or both ingredients could be responsible. The first is Mebendazole, and no longer available in the US. The second is Dylox (aka Tricholorfon), which is no longer marked for aquatic use and getting hard to find in general. Both are pesticides that need to be used with caution.
